Output 39abf1c20670649e155edc8d49a8b61d78f0225b6c6ed4331bbc2ff3185033f0:0

value
15425437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4fca911e939e9723b6a706bbf89c2545eea6a92 OP_EQUAL
address
MNwXj3YufJ1N4juiB9zMPwBjjruCVJAUro
transaction
39abf1c20670649e155edc8d49a8b61d78f0225b6c6ed4331bbc2ff3185033f0
spent
true